Too many of them are also stock characters who are almost cartoonish in their qualities – the criminal mastermind with a preternatural knowledge of every element of street life throughout Oslo and beyond; the wise, hard-working office cleaner who offers life insights to the detective; the incompetent agent from the FBI-style agency outsmarted by the local cops; the detective with the addiction problem.
